Acute symptoms of private part eczema

The specific manifestations are severe itching and focal redness of the private parts. The skin lesions are polymorphic without obvious boundaries. As the disease progresses, needle-sized papules, papulovesicles or small blisters appear on the skin surface, and basal hematomas are found, with unclear boundaries of damage. This will aggravate erosion, edema and extravasation.

Scratching accompanied by a burning sensation and intense itching may injure the skin, leading to infection and scarring. It may also be accompanied by symptoms such as groin lymph node enlargement, fever, and general malaise. If not treated properly, repeated attacks can prolong the current medical history and turn it into a chronic disease.

Chronic stage of private eczema

Due to repeated scratching, a small amount of plasma exudation will occur in the affected area, and the condition will become difficult to cure. It causes infiltration and hypertrophy in the epidermis and dermis, and the skin becomes rough. It may become lichen-like and hardened with clear boundaries. The surface may often have bran-like desquamation. It may feel hard or have moist scabs. In severe cases, it may become dry and cracked, and there may be pain during movement. The skin may appear dark brown or depigmented due to crusting and pigmentation.
